Transaction 108114354c73068f6d6850d364a244b39f01ae68828f73f3474b0b55de221d8a

1 Input
2 Outputs
  • 108114354c73068f6d6850d364a244b39f01ae68828f73f3474b0b55de221d8a:0
  • value  1036713
    address  38R567i2Xs91eJMBdUPmWsc6KQFW2umtLN
  • 108114354c73068f6d6850d364a244b39f01ae68828f73f3474b0b55de221d8a:1
  • value  4936167
    address  1CbNr3LXnqjGpdtVwVDYSLnybqdduu2YxU